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 13
  1. #1
    Utente di HTML.it L'avatar di Grinder
    Registrato dal
    Mar 2003
    Messaggi
    1,374

    Variabile ASP in Javascript

    Non sapevo se postare quì o su Scripting, spero di averci preso! Allora io ho uno script in Javascript:
    codice:
    <script language="JavaScript" type="text/JavaScript">
    // script by assoultra
    
    // valore iniziale in euro
    var valore_iniziale=50;
    // totale iniziale
    var totale=valore_iniziale;
    // valuta
    valuta = "&euro;"
    
    function modifica(check_box) {
    
    if(totale>=valore_iniziale && check_box!=="") {
    document.all.prezzo.innerHTML = "";
    valore = document.form1[check_box].value;
    if(document.form1[check_box].checked == true) {
    // somma se selezionato
    totale = (Math.round(totale)+Math.round(valore));
    } else {
    // sottrazione se non è selezionato
    totale = (Math.round(totale)-Math.round(valore));
    }
    }
    // popolo lo span in base al totale modificato
    if(document.all.prezzo) { 
    document.all.prezzo.innerHTML = totale+valuta;
    } else {
    return false;
    }
    }
    // ciclo per verificare per aggiunger eil valore del radio selezionato 
    // e sottrarre il vecchio valore selezionato uso: <input onclick("verifica_radio(this.name)")
    var vecchio_valore_radio=0;
    function verifica_radio(nome_radio) {
    for (i=0;i<document.form1[nome_radio].length;i++){
    if (document.form1[nome_radio][i].checked==true && totale>=valore_iniziale) {
     document.all.prezzo.innerHTML = "";
     totale = (Math.round(totale)-Math.round(vecchio_valore_radio));
     totale = (Math.round(totale)+Math.round(document.form1[nome_radio][i].value));
     vecchio_valore_radio = document.form1[nome_radio][i].value;
     break
    } 
    }
    // popolo lo span in base al totale modificato
    if(document.all.prezzo) { 
    document.all.prezzo.innerHTML = totale+valuta;
    } else {
    return false;
    }
    }
    //-->
    </script>
    Vorrei poter inserire la variabile "valore_iniziale" da database, come posso fare?

  2. #2
    Utente di HTML.it L'avatar di diegoctn
    Registrato dal
    May 2001
    Messaggi
    2,118
    Presumo: fai una query dove prendi il valore xxx. Dopodiche:

    codice:
    <script language="JavaScript" type="text/JavaScript">
    // script by assoultra
    
    // valore iniziale in euro
    var valore_iniziale=<%=rs("xxx")%>;
    // totale iniziale
    var totale=valore_iniziale;
    // valuta
    valuta = "€"
    Dovrebbe andare.

  3. #3
    Utente di HTML.it L'avatar di Grinder
    Registrato dal
    Mar 2003
    Messaggi
    1,374
    Magari...ma non è possibile usare codice ASP dentro ad un codice Java

  4. #4
    Moderatore di ASP e MS Server L'avatar di Roby_72
    Registrato dal
    Aug 2001
    Messaggi
    19,559
    Originariamente inviato da Grinder
    Magari...ma non è possibile usare codice ASP dentro ad un codice Java
    A me una cosa del genere funziona...

    Roby

  5. #5
    Utente di HTML.it L'avatar di Grinder
    Registrato dal
    Mar 2003
    Messaggi
    1,374
    A me no, l'ho provato e mi da errore subito...tu come fai?

  6. #6
    Moderatore di ASP e MS Server L'avatar di Roby_72
    Registrato dal
    Aug 2001
    Messaggi
    19,559
    Errore cosa?
    ASP o js?

    Roby

  7. #7
    Utente di HTML.it L'avatar di Grinder
    Registrato dal
    Mar 2003
    Messaggi
    1,374
    Errore in javascript, io però lo script lo allego, non è parte della pagina

  8. #8
    Moderatore di ASP e MS Server L'avatar di Roby_72
    Registrato dal
    Aug 2001
    Messaggi
    19,559
    Originariamente inviato da Grinder
    Errore in javascript, io però lo script lo allego, non è parte della pagina
    Che vuol dire?

    Roby

  9. #9
    Utente di HTML.it L'avatar di Grinder
    Registrato dal
    Mar 2003
    Messaggi
    1,374
    E' incluso, inserito, allegato (come si dice?)...

    <script language="JavaScript" src="../Scripts/price_calculator.js"></script>

  10. #10
    Moderatore di ASP e MS Server L'avatar di Roby_72
    Registrato dal
    Aug 2001
    Messaggi
    19,559
    Così non funziona!

    Roby

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.